Tablets
1. Wacom

Within the X11 environment Wacom tablets are best supported, among SummaGraphics tablets. XFree86 has the best support (Jan, 2000) for the tablets, whereas XIG Xaccelerated server lacks of options, but has better X11-performance.

The Wacom Intuos are available in several sizes ($100-$800), whereas the Wacom Graphire is a good low-cost approach ($80).

High-end (or better said high-price) solution are the PL-300 and PL-400, LCD screen with integrated tablet, great concept, but with $3,000 indiscussable overpriced (check keyboard-less I-Appliances which will sell arround $400-$600 fall 2000).

XFree86
 With XFree86 the table is supported via Xinput extension, and it has many options for the /etc/XF86Config, be aware that some setup programs overwrite hand-written add-ons you did.
